I. What Are Fog Lights and How Do They Work?

At their core, fog lights are auxiliary lighting units engineered to provide a specific type of illumination in adverse weather conditions. Unlike standard headlights, which are designed for broad, long-range illumination, fog lights project a low, wide, and flat beam of light. This unique beam pattern is crucial for several reasons:

  • Low Placement: Fog lights are typically mounted lower on the vehicle, usually in or below the front bumper. This low position allows the light to pass under the densest part of the fog or mist, which often hovers a few feet above the ground.
  • Wide Spread: The wide beam pattern illuminates the road shoulders and immediate surroundings, helping drivers identify lane markings, road edges, and potential hazards that might otherwise be obscured.
  • Flat Cut-Off: The sharp, horizontal cut-off of the beam prevents the light from scattering upwards into the fog, which is what causes the blinding glare experienced with regular headlights in foggy conditions. By keeping the light low, reflections are minimized, improving forward visibility.

While many fog lights emit a white light, traditional and often preferred fog lights utilize an amber or yellow hue. This is because yellow light has a longer wavelength and scatters less when hitting water droplets or dust particles, further reducing glare and making it easier for the human eye to perceive contrast in low-visibility environments.

II. Why Are Fog Lights Essential for Trucks?

For trucks, which are larger, heavier, and require greater stopping distances, the importance of enhanced visibility cannot be overstated. Fog lights offer a multitude of benefits that directly contribute to safer operation:

  • Enhanced Safety: The primary benefit. By illuminating the immediate road ahead and shoulders without causing glare, fog lights allow truck drivers to see obstacles, road deviations, and other vehicles much sooner, providing critical reaction time.
  • Increased Visibility TO Others: While improving the driver’s view, fog lights also make the truck significantly more visible to oncoming traffic and vehicles ahead, especially in conditions where a large truck might otherwise blend into the murk. This is vital for preventing collisions.
  • Reduced Glare and Eye Strain: The specialized beam pattern cuts through fog and precipitation rather than reflecting off it, drastically reducing the glare that exhausts the driver’s eyes and makes driving stressful and dangerous.
  • Navigating Challenging Conditions: Beyond fog, these lights are highly effective in heavy rain, blizzards, dust storms, and even dense smoke, providing a crucial layer of visibility when standard headlights are insufficient.
  • Compliance & Regulations: In some jurisdictions, having functional fog lights is a legal requirement or highly recommended for commercial vehicles operating in certain conditions, underlining their perceived importance by regulatory bodies.
  • Aesthetic Appeal: While secondary, modern fog lights, especially integrated LED units, can significantly enhance the front-end appearance of a truck, giving it a more robust and complete look.

III. Types of Fog Lights for Trucks

Fog lights for trucks come in various forms, primarily categorized by their light source technology, mounting location, and beam pattern. Understanding these types is crucial for making the right choice.

A. Bulb Technology:

  • Halogen: These are the traditional, most affordable option. They produce a warm, yellowish light and are readily available. While effective, they consume more power, generate more heat, and have a shorter lifespan compared to newer technologies.
  • LED (Light Emitting Diode): Rapidly gaining popularity, LED fog lights are highly energy-efficient, produce very bright and crisp light, and boast an incredibly long lifespan (tens of thousands of hours). They offer various color temperatures, including amber, and are highly durable.
  • HID (High-Intensity Discharge): Less common for dedicated fog lights due to their warm-up time and intense brightness (which can cause glare if not properly aimed), HIDs offer very powerful illumination. They are more complex to install, requiring ballasts, and are generally more expensive.

B. Mounting Location:

  • Bumper-Mounted: This is the most common and effective location, as it places the lights low to the ground, optimizing their ability to cut under fog. Many trucks come with factory cut-outs for these.
  • Grille-Mounted: Some aftermarket options allow for mounting within or behind the truck’s grille. While aesthetically pleasing, their slightly higher position might marginally reduce effectiveness compared to bumper mounts.
  • Auxiliary Light Bars/Pods: While many light bars are designed for off-road or driving illumination, some manufacturers offer specific pod lights or sections within a light bar that feature a dedicated fog beam pattern. These are versatile but require careful selection to ensure a true fog pattern.

C. Beam Pattern:

  • Dedicated Fog Beam: This is the ideal pattern – a wide, flat, and low beam with a sharp cut-off. It’s specifically engineered to maximize visibility in fog without causing reflective glare.
  • Driving Lights: Often confused with fog lights, driving lights produce a narrower, longer-range beam designed to supplement high beams for extended visibility on clear, dark roads. They are not suitable for fog.
  • Combo Patterns: Some lights claim to offer both driving and fog patterns. While versatile, dedicated fog lights generally perform better for their specific purpose.

IV. Choosing the Right Fog Lights for Your Truck

Selecting the optimal fog lights for your truck involves considering several key factors to ensure they meet your needs and perform effectively.

  • Compatibility: The first step is to ensure the fog lights are compatible with your truck’s make, model, and year. Many aftermarket kits are "plug-and-play" for specific vehicles, simplifying installation. Consider if your truck has existing wiring or if a new harness will be needed.
  • Brightness (Lumens): While brighter often seems better, excessively bright fog lights can actually worsen glare in dense fog. Look for a balance – enough lumens to penetrate the haze but not so much that they become counterproductive or blind others.
  • Beam Pattern: This is paramount. Always prioritize a true fog beam pattern (SAE J583 or ECE R19 compliant) – wide, low, and with a sharp cut-off. Avoid lights designed primarily for off-road or long-range driving.
  • Color Temperature: Decide between amber (yellow) and white light. Amber is traditionally preferred for its glare-reducing properties, especially in severe conditions. White LEDs offer modern aesthetics and strong illumination, but can sometimes cause slightly more glare than amber in very dense fog.
  • Durability and Construction: Trucks operate in harsh environments. Look for lights with robust, corrosion-resistant housings (e.g., aluminum) and high IP (Ingress Protection) ratings (e.g., IP67 or IP68) to ensure resistance against water, dust, and vibrations.
  • Ease of Installation: Consider whether you prefer a direct bolt-on replacement, a universal kit requiring custom wiring, or professional installation. Plug-and-play kits are convenient but may limit options.
  • Budget: Prices vary significantly based on technology, brand, and features. Set a realistic budget, but remember that investing in quality fog lights is an investment in safety.
  • Legal Compliance: Check local and state regulations regarding auxiliary lighting. Some areas have specific rules about color, brightness, and when fog lights can be used.

V. Installation and Maintenance Tips

Proper installation and regular maintenance are crucial for the optimal performance and longevity of your truck’s fog lights.

A. Installation:

  • DIY vs. Professional: If you’re comfortable with basic automotive wiring and tools, many aftermarket fog light kits can be installed DIY. However, if your truck doesn’t have existing fog light wiring, or if you’re installing complex LED or HID systems, professional installation is recommended to ensure correct wiring, relay integration, and proper aiming.
  • Basic Steps (General Overview):
    1. Mounting: Securely attach the light units to the designated bumper mounts or brackets.
    2. Wiring: Connect the lights to the truck’s electrical system, typically involving a relay, an in-cabin switch, and a power source (often directly from the battery with an inline fuse). Ensure all connections are secure and weatherproof.
    3. Aiming: This is critical. Fog lights must be aimed correctly to be effective and avoid blinding oncoming drivers. They should be aimed low and slightly downward, with the top of the beam cut-off below the headlight beam. Most manufacturers provide aiming guidelines. Use a flat wall or garage door to adjust.

B. Maintenance:

  • Regular Cleaning: Keep the lenses clean from dirt, mud, salt, and road grime. A dirty lens can significantly reduce light output and effectiveness.
  • Check Connections: Periodically inspect wiring connections for corrosion or looseness, especially after off-road excursions or harsh weather.
  • Bulb Replacement (for Halogen/HID): If you have non-LED fog lights, replace bulbs as needed. It’s often recommended to replace both bulbs at the same time to maintain consistent light output.
  • Inspect for Damage: Check the housing and lenses for cracks or physical damage, which can compromise their water resistance and performance.

C. Proper Usage:

  • When to Use: Only activate fog lights in conditions of reduced visibility (fog, heavy rain, snow, dust) where your low beams are ineffective or causing glare.
  • Use with Low Beams: Fog lights are designed to supplement, not replace, your low beam headlights. They should almost always be used in conjunction with low beams.
  • When NOT to Use: Never use fog lights in clear weather. They are designed for specific conditions and can blind other drivers, especially if improperly aimed. Turn them off as soon as visibility improves.

VI. Practical Advice and Actionable Insights

  • Invest in Quality: For a critical safety feature, skimping on quality can be counterproductive. Choose reputable brands known for durability and performance.
  • Consider a Wiring Harness: If your truck didn’t come with factory fog lights, a dedicated wiring harness with a relay and switch is essential for safe and proper operation, preventing electrical overloads.
  • Don’t Overlook Aiming: Even the best fog lights will be useless or even dangerous if not aimed correctly. Take the time to aim them precisely.
  • Regular Checks: Make checking your fog lights part of your pre-trip inspection routine, especially before long hauls or anticipated bad weather.
  • Understand Your Truck’s Electrical System: Be aware of your truck’s electrical capacity. Adding numerous auxiliary lights can strain the alternator and battery if not properly managed.

Frequently Asked Questions (FAQ)

Q1: Can I use fog lights as DRLs (Daytime Running Lights)?
A1: No. While some modern fog light units might incorporate a DRL function, standard fog lights are designed for low-visibility conditions and are too bright and focused to be used safely as DRLs in clear weather.

Q2: Are amber or white fog lights better?
A2: For optimal performance in dense fog, amber (yellow) fog lights are generally considered superior. Yellow light scatters less off water droplets, reducing glare and improving contrast for the human eye. White lights are more common and aesthetically preferred by some but can cause slightly more glare in very thick fog.

Q3: Do fog lights help in heavy rain?
A3: Yes, absolutely. The same principle that applies to fog (cutting under the particles to reduce reflection) also applies to heavy rain or snow, where the low, wide beam can significantly improve visibility of lane markers and the immediate road ahead.

Q4: Is it illegal to drive with fog lights on when there’s no fog?
A4: In many regions, yes. Driving with fog lights on in clear conditions is often illegal as they can cause excessive glare for oncoming drivers, especially if improperly aimed. Always check your local traffic laws.

Q5: How often should I replace my fog light bulbs?
A5: For halogen bulbs, replacement is typically every 200-500 hours of use, or when they burn out. LED fog lights have a much longer lifespan, often exceeding 20,000-50,000 hours, meaning they may never need replacement during the truck’s life.

Q6: What’s the difference between fog lights and driving lights?
A6: The key difference is their beam pattern and intended use. Fog lights produce a wide, low, and flat beam to illuminate the immediate road in low visibility. Driving lights produce a narrower, long-range beam to supplement high beams for extended visibility on clear, dark roads. They are not interchangeable for their specific purposes.
